**Action item (INC follow-up): Varrow Assign service**

Sticky assignments expired early during the outage, so some users flipped experiment arms mid-session. Support: if customers report inconsistent features, check assignment timestamps before escalating. Fix shipped; TTLs and cache bounds were retuned to prevent recurrence. Do not manually reassign users. Escalate only if flips persist past the new TTL window. Revised constants are listed below.

tuning table, yaweg-kajef:
WEIGHTS = {
    "ralwyn": 573,
    "praius": 56,
    "eliok": 19,
}

Action item: The Relayn deploy-status bot silently dropped updates when the pipeline API paginated results, so responders believed a rollback had completed when it had not. We will add pagination handling, a staleness banner, and an integration test. Until merged, verify deploy state directly in the pipeline console, documented at the page below.

runbook for kahop-kajop: https://rundeck.ordinio.test/display/secrets/pipeline/issue/pages/repo/browse/e5732776e07d1285107e5aeb

### Item 7 — Shared component library versioning

Confirm that the Glintbox component library follows strict semantic versioning and that no consuming service pins to a floating `latest` tag. Check the release notes for breaking changes flagged since the last audit, and verify the deprecation window of two minor versions was honored. If an unversioned reference is found during an incident, page the library maintainer recorded immediately below.

account owner for tawef-yadug: Jorius Normir Silath

## Introduce per-tenant rate quotas in the Orvane gateway

For the release manager: this change replaces our global throttle with per-tenant quotas, resolved at request time from the tenant registry and cached for sixty seconds. Tenants without an explicit quota inherit the tier default; overage returns a retryable status with a hint header. Rollout is gated behind a flag, defaulting off, and the old throttle remains as a backstop until two clean release cycles pass.

The initial tier defaults we intend to ship are listed below.

limits module of taguf-hafog:
WEIGHTS = {
    "wenox": 690,
    "wenok": 782,
    "kelax": 41,
    "holox": 338,
    "quenir": 39,
}